摘要
Conventional non-uniform wettability surfaces typically employ hydrophilic surfaces for water collection and hydrophobic surfaces for water drainage. Such surfaces often suffer from droplet pinning, leading to widespread surface coverage by liquid bridges that obscure functional surfaces or structures. Inspired by the curved back structure of beetles and the grooved veins of rice leaves, this study designed a functional surface integrating curved geometric features with dual heterogeneous wettability (DHWS). Using electrical discharge wire cutting and nanosecond laser processing techniques, curved surface arrays and micro-groove structures were fabricated on copper content of 62 % brass surfaces. Combined with the wettability contrast between a waxy hydrophobic coating and hydrophilic channels, this enables efficient droplet nucleation, rapid coalescence, and directional transport. On this surface, the curved structures significantly enhance droplet nucleation efficiency. The unique U-shaped grooves accelerate droplet coalescence, while the hydrophobic-hydrophilic wettability difference promotes rapid droplet drainage along the hydrophilic channels via capillary forces. Compared to traditional fog collection surfaces, this wettability reversal design (hydrophobic collection / hydrophilic drainage) coupled with groove-accelerated coalescence can largely eliminate droplet pinning. This prevents liquid bridges from forming due to droplets lingering on the surface, thereby avoiding obstruction of subsequent fog collection. Ultimately, the DHWS achieved a water collection efficiency of 0.668 g·cm −2 ·h −1 , representing a 98 % improvement over the original surface. This research elucidates the mechanism by which curved geometric morphology and wettability synergistically regulate droplet behavior. The findings hold significant promise for applications in water resource management and environmental protection. • Hydrophobic water capture / hydrophilic drainage design. • Beetle-inspired curves + rice leaf-like U-grooves with dual wettability. • Curvature boosts nucleation; grooves accelerate coalescence & directional transport.
